Improved Wilson QCD simulations at light quark masses
A. C. Irving, UKQCD Collaboration
Abstract
We present preliminary results from UKQCD simulations at light quark masses using two flavours of non-pertubatively improved Wilson fermions. We report on the performance of the standard HMC algorithm at these quark masses where mpi/mrho < 0.5 in comparison with simulations using improved staggered quarks.
